The total area of Nepal is 147,516 sq km, and the total area of Iceland is 103,125 sq km. Nepal is bigger than Iceland by 44,391 sq km. Nepal is around 1.43 times bigger than Iceland.

Based on the elaboration of latest World Bank Data, the total population of Nepal as of 2023 is estimated to be around 30,896,590, and the total population of Iceland as of 2023 is estimated to be around 393,600.
As per the above data, we can say that in the year 2023, Nepal had 30,502,990 more people than Iceland.
The annual Population Growth in Nepal is 1.22% and the annual population growth in Iceland is 1.97%.

The leading cause of death in Nepal, is [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ease ]. Around 94.5 people per 100,000 people in Nepal, are dying of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ease.
Similarly, around 119 people per 100,000 people in Iceland, are dying of Ischaemic heart disease, as it is the leading cause of death in there.
The government of Nepal, spent [ 5.42% ] of the amount of the Gross Domestic Product (GDP) in health sectors in the year 2023.
Likewise, the government of Iceland, spent [ 9.73% ] of the amount of the Gross Domestic Product (GDP) in health sectors in the year 2023.
